Planning and Research for Domestic Travel Tips

Importance of Pre-Trip Planning

Effective planning is the foundation of hassle-free Domestic Travel Tips. Researching the destination, understanding weather conditions, knowing peak travel periods, and booking services in advance significantly reduce last-minute issues. Planning also helps optimize the itinerary, allowing travelers to cover key attractions without rushing.

Itinerary Development

A flexible but structured itinerary is ideal. Mapping out transportation, accommodations, and attractions helps balance sightseeing with downtime. Allocating time for meals, rest, and unplanned exploration ensures a more relaxed experience.

Route and Accessibility Considerations

Understanding road conditions, traffic patterns, and connectivity options—such as flights, trains, or buses—helps avoid delays. Routes should be planned with local factors in mind, including regional holidays or festivals, which can affect crowd levels and service availability.


Transportation Strategies

Choosing the Right Mode of Travel

Domestic Travel Tips offers multiple options: flights, trains, buses, or personal vehicles. Selecting the most suitable mode depends on distance, comfort, budget, and time constraints. For short distances, road Domestic Travel Tips may be more flexible, while longer trips might be faster by air.

Booking and Ticket Management

Booking tickets in advance guarantees availability, often at better prices. Digital tickets reduce paperwork and allow easy tracking. Monitoring booking policies, cancellation options, and peak Domestic Travel Tips charges ensures financial flexibility.

Local Transportation

Efficient use of local transportation—such as taxis, rideshare apps, or metro services—saves time and reduces stress. Understanding local routes, peak hours, and fare structures can prevent unnecessary delays or extra costs.


Accommodation Tips

Researching Suitable Stays

Choosing the right accommodation impacts comfort and convenience. Researching hotels, guesthouses, or homestays based on location, amenities, cleanliness, and reviews ensures a pleasant stay.

Location Considerations

Staying close to major attractions or transportation hubs saves commuting time. For urban travel, proximity to metro stations or bus stops enhances convenience, while rural destinations may require accommodations near main roads.

Amenities and Services

Assessing amenities such as Wi-Fi, laundry facilities, room service, or parking can improve comfort, particularly for longer trips or family Domestic Travel Tips. Accessibility features are important for travelers with special needs.


Packing and Essentials

Lightweight and Efficient Packing

Overpacking increases fatigue and complicates mobility. Packing should prioritize essentials while ensuring comfort. Using Domestic Travel Tips-friendly luggage, organizing items in packing cubes, and adhering to airline weight limits (if applicable) streamlines the process.

Travel Documents and Identification

Carrying valid identification, tickets, hotel confirmations, and necessary permits prevents delays and legal issues. Digital backups of documents on smartphones or cloud storage add security.

Health and Safety Kits

Basic first-aid supplies, prescription medications, hand sanitizers, and personal hygiene items should be included. For regions with extreme weather, packing sunscreen, insect repellent, or warm clothing ensures preparedness.


Health and Safety Considerations

Vaccinations and Health Precautions

Some domestic regions may require specific vaccinations or health checks. Staying informed about local health advisories prevents illness and ensures a safe journey.

Travel Insurance

Domestic Travel Tips insurance covers accidents, medical emergencies, or lost baggage. While optional for short trips, insurance adds peace of mind, particularly for family or adventure Domestic Travel Tips.

Emergency Preparedness

Keeping emergency contacts, local hospital numbers, and embassy or consulate information (if applicable) accessible ensures quick action during unexpected situations.


Budget Management

Pre-Planned Expenses

Creating a budget covering transportation, accommodation, food, sightseeing, and miscellaneous costs prevents overspending. Researching average local costs allows realistic planning.

Contingency Funds

Unexpected expenses are common in travel. Maintaining a contingency fund for emergencies or unforeseen events prevents financial stress.

Cost Tracking

Using digital tools or simple spreadsheets to track daily spending ensures adherence to the budget and prevents post-trip surprises.


Enhancing the Local Experience

Cultural Awareness

Understanding local customs, traditions, and etiquette fosters respect and smoother interactions with locals. This knowledge enhances the overall Domestic Travel Tips experience.

Exploring Local Cuisine

Sampling regional dishes is a key aspect of Domestic Travel Tips. Being aware of dietary considerations, hygiene, and popular local specialties improves safety and enjoyment.

Participating in Festivals and Events

Engaging with local events adds richness to the journey. Researching event schedules in advance helps Domestic Travel Tips avoid crowds or capitalize on unique cultural experiences.


Digital Tools for Efficient Travel

Navigation and Maps

Using GPS apps or offline maps reduces the risk of getting lost, optimizes travel routes, and saves time.

Travel Planning Applications

Trip planners, itinerary managers, and booking platforms centralize information, making Domestic Travel Tips more organized and less stressful.

Digital Wallets and Payment Apps

Cashless transactions through digital wallets streamline payments, reduce the need for local currency, and enhance security.


Time Management on the Road

Early Departures and Scheduling Breaks

Starting travel early avoids traffic and allows more time at destinations. Scheduling short breaks prevents fatigue during long road trips.

Efficient Sightseeing Strategies

Prioritizing key attractions and grouping nearby sites improves efficiency and reduces unnecessary travel time.

Managing Travel Fatigue

Adequate sleep, hydration, and light meals during Domestic Travel Tips maintain energy levels and alertness, ensuring a more enjoyable experience.


Sustainability in Domestic Travel Tips

Eco-Friendly Travel Choices

Choosing public transport, fuel-efficient vehicles, or walking reduces carbon footprints. Conscious Domestic Travel Tips also includes minimizing single-use plastics and supporting local eco-friendly initiatives.

Supporting Local Economies

Purchasing local products, dining at small eateries, and hiring local guides benefits regional communities while enriching the travel experience.

Responsible Behavior

Respecting natural habitats, adhering to local rules, and minimizing waste contribute to sustainable tourism practices and preserve destinations for future travelers.


Common Challenges and How to Overcome Them

Flight or Train Delays

Monitoring schedules, having alternative routes, and allowing buffer times reduce the impact of travel delays.

Language Barriers

Learning basic local phrases or using translation apps facilitates communication in regions with different dialects.

Unexpected Weather

Checking forecasts, carrying appropriate clothing, and maintaining flexible plans prevent disruptions caused by weather changes.

Crowds and Peak Seasons

Traveling during off-peak times, booking attractions in advance, and exploring less popular destinations avoid congestion and enhance the experience.
